Chess Puzzle #LPGXo — Intermediate, Black to move, middlegame

Rating 1420 · Intermediate · kingside attack, mate, mate in 1, middlegame, one move, pin.

Position

White: king g1; queen d1; rooks b1/f1; bishops c1/e2; pawns a2/c2/f4/g2/h3. Black: king e8; queen c3; rooks c8/h8; bishops b7/d4; pawns a6/d7/e6/f7/h7. Material is balanced. Black to move.

Solution (1 move)

  1. Opponent setup: Kh1 — king g1→h1. Now Black to move.
  2. Best move: Qxh3# — queen c3→h3, captures pawn, delivers checkmate.

Tactical themes

kingside attack, mate, mate in 1, middlegame, one move, pin. The combination ends with Qxh3# delivering checkmate.
